We are seeking a reliable and motivated individual to join our team as a Shift Supervisor. The Shift Supervisor will be responsible for overseeing the operations during their assigned shifts, ensuring exceptional customer service, maintaining quality standards, and leading the team to achieve performance goals.
Responsibilities:
Supervise Shift Operations: Direct and oversee all activities during assigned shifts, including opening or closing procedures, ensuring adherence to operational standards, and resolving any issues that may arise.
Team Leadership: Lead and motivate team members to deliver excellent customer service, maintain cleanliness, and uphold food safety standards.
Training and Development: Train new team members on restaurant procedures, safety protocols, and customer service standards. Provide ongoing coaching and feedback to support staff development.
Customer Satisfaction: Ensure that all guests have a positive experience by addressing any concerns or complaints promptly and effectively. Monitor service quality and take corrective actions as needed.
Inventory Management: Assist with inventory control, including monitoring stock levels, placing orders, and managing product rotation to minimize waste and ensure freshness.
Cash Handling: Oversee cash register operations, including handling cash transactions, processing payments, and balancing cash drawers at the end of the shift.
Safety and Compliance: Maintain a safe and clean work environment by enforcing safety guidelines, sanitation standards, and health regulations. Ensure compliance with all company policies and procedures.
Problem Solving: Proactively identify operational challenges and implement solutions to improve efficiency, productivity, and customer satisfaction.
Communication: Effectively communicate with team members, management, and other departments to relay information, coordinate activities, and ensure smooth operations.
Opening/Closing Duties: Perform opening and closing duties as required, including preparing equipment and supplies, conducting pre-shift meetings, and securing the premises at the end of the shift.
Qualifications:
Previous experience in a supervisory role in the restaurant industry preferred.
Strong leadership and communication skills.
Excellent customer service skills with a friendly and approachable demeanor.
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ment and handle multiple tasks simultaneously.
Knowledge of food safety and sanitation regulations.
Basic math skills and proficiency in cash handling.
